首页 » SEO关键词 » C程序代码,探索计算机世界的基石

C程序代码,探索计算机世界的基石

duote123 2025-03-09 0

扫一扫用手机浏览

文章目录 [+]

在计算机科学领域,C语言作为一种历史悠久、应用广泛的高级编程语言,被誉为“计算机世界的基石”。自1972年由美国贝尔实验室的Dennis Ritchie发明以来,C语言以其高效、灵活和强大的功能,成为无数程序员心中不可或缺的编程工具。本文将围绕C程序代码展开,探讨其在计算机领域的地位、应用以及未来发展。

一、C程序代码的地位

C程序代码,探索计算机世界的基石 C程序代码,探索计算机世界的基石 SEO关键词

作为一门高级编程语言,C语言具有以下特点:

C程序代码,探索计算机世界的基石 C程序代码,探索计算机世界的基石 SEO关键词
(图片来自网络侵删)

1. 高效性:C语言编写的程序执行速度快,资源占用少,能够充分发挥硬件性能。

2. 灵活性:C语言提供了丰富的数据类型和运算符,便于程序员进行各种编程任务。

3. 强大性:C语言具有丰富的库函数和强大的扩展能力,可以轻松实现复杂的系统功能。

4. 可移植性:C语言编写的程序可以在不同的操作系统和硬件平台上运行,具有良好的可移植性。

正是基于这些特点,C语言在计算机领域占据着举足轻重的地位。许多知名操作系统、编译器和应用程序都是基于C语言编写的,如UNIX、Linux、Windows、Mac OS等。

二、C程序代码的应用

C语言的应用范围十分广泛,主要包括以下领域:

1. 操作系统:C语言是编写操作系统的首选语言,许多操作系统都是基于C语言开发的。

2. 网络编程:C语言在网络编程领域具有广泛的应用,如TCP/IP协议栈、网络设备驱动程序等。

3. 图形编程:C语言在图形编程领域有着丰富的库函数,如OpenGL、DirectX等。

4. 数据库编程:C语言可以用于数据库编程,如MySQL、Oracle等数据库的客户端程序。

5. 嵌入式系统:C语言在嵌入式系统领域具有广泛应用,如嵌入式操作系统、嵌入式设备驱动程序等。

三、C程序代码的未来发展

随着计算机技术的不断发展,C语言也在不断演变。以下是C程序代码未来发展的几个趋势:

1. C11标准:C11是C语言的新标准,它增加了许多新特性,如泛型编程、可变参数等,使C语言更加现代化。

2. C++与C的融合:C++在C语言的基础上发展而来,它继承了C语言的特点,并增加了面向对象编程等特性。未来,C与C++的融合将成为一种趋势。

3. 跨平台开发:随着跨平台技术的发展,C语言将更加注重跨平台兼容性,为程序员提供更便捷的开发环境。

4. AI与C语言的结合:随着人工智能技术的快速发展,C语言将在AI领域发挥重要作用,如深度学习、计算机视觉等。

C程序代码在计算机领域具有不可替代的地位。随着技术的不断进步,C语言将继续发展壮大,为计算机世界的繁荣作出更大贡献。

参考文献:

[1] Kernighan, B. W., & Ritchie, D. M. (1988). The C programming language. Prentice-Hall.

[2] Ritchie, D. M. (1973). The development of the C language. IEEE Computer, 6(1), 6-13.

[3] Stroustrup, B. (1994). C++: the good parts. Addison-Wesley Professional.

标签:

相关文章